· Main functions of EMB : Article 45 of the Constitution 1992; Electoral Commission Act 1993:
- To compile the register of voters (see Voter registration and voters' rolls) and revise it as such periods as may be determined by law;
- To undertake the delimitation of constituencies for both national and local government elections;
- To conduct and supervise all public elections and referenda (See Voting process, Secrecy of the ballot, Counting and Announcement of results);
- To educate the people on the electoral process and its purpose (see Civic and voter education);
- To undertake programmes for the expansion of the registration of voters (see Voter registration and voters' rolls); and
- To perform such other functions as may be prescribed by law (see Election period and dates), overseeing Candidate nominations and accrediting and Election observation missions).
- To undertake the preparation of voter identity cards (see Voter registration and voters' rolls); and
- To store properly election material.
